One of the best things about this dish is that it relies on fresh ingredients. For this recipe, cherry tomatoes or Roma tomatoes are an excellent choice. Cherry tomatoes add sweetness and juiciness, while Roma tomatoes, with their meatier texture, provide a rich flavor that enhances the sauce.
Spaghetti Pomodoro is a dish that originates from the heart of Italy, where simplicity and fresh ingredients are the foundation of good cooking.
The word "pomodoro" means "tomato" in Italian. Spaghetti Pomodoro is a staple dish in Italian households, especially during the summer months when tomatoes are at their peak. Adding fresh basil and a generous amount of grated Parmesan elevates the dish, adding layers of flavor and aroma that are typically Italian.
